How Random in Java Actually Works — Practical Insights
Java doesn’t generate “true” randomness by default—well, not for most use cases—because reliability matters. But with built-in tools like java.util.Random, combined with smart seeding and integration into testing or data workflows, developers can introduce controlled variance. For example, generating randomized test inputs, shuffling dataset orders at runtime, or simulating varied user interactions during load testing all contribute to more resilient applications.

Using Random wisely—seeding early, managing state, and limiting exposure—lets teams gain flexibility without compromising determinism where needed. This foundational use forms the essence of the “Ultimate Hack”: leveraging randomness not to chaos, but to improve adaptability and robustness.
Common Questions About “Random in Java: The Ultimate Hack”
Q: Isn’t randomness in Java inherently unreliable?
A: Java’s built-in Random class provides consistent behavior when properly seeded. Randomness is introduced deliberately, often for testing or simulation—not as a replacement for deterministic logic.
Q: How do I avoid introducing security risks with randomness?
A: Use SecureRandom for cryptographic operations or sensitive random state generation. Regular Random suffices for simulations, testing, and UI logic.
Q: Can randomness slow down performance?
A: Minimal when used judiciously. Overuse or improper state management can lead to contention, but optimized calls maintain speed while adding smart variability.
